하니웰 EBI Documentation

1.목적 #

This document is intended to instruct the user on how to synchronize an XPressEntry mobile access control system with a Honeywell EBI access control system.

This will allow XPressEntry to have a copy of the Cardholders and Cards and their access privileges from EBI. Activity records cannot be pushed back into EBI at this time.

1.1.가정 #

이 문서는 몇 가지 가정을합니다.

  1. 독자는 XPressEntry 시스템 및 용어에 익숙합니다. 기본 설정 및 XPressEntry 사용법은 기본 XPressEntry 설명서에서 확인할 수 있습니다.
  2. 독자는 Microsoft SQL Server Management Studio에 대해 기본적으로 이해하고 있습니다.
  3. The Honeywell EBI installation is administered by someone with knowledge and access to SQL Server commands.
  4. Honeywell EBI includes the Cardholder Services module.

1.2.설치 #

We will not cover installation of either XPressEntry or Honeywell EBI here. Refer to the appropriate manual to get that set up.

2.EBI Setup and SQL Server #

2.1.EBI Server Version #

In order for the XPressEntry integration with Cardholder Services to work properly, EBI needs to be using at least version 410.2 and have the following patch or equivalent installed: Version: Server_R410_2_SP1_ISR159842_Cardholder_Services_Update.exe

2.2.Is EBI Running #

For Cardholder Services to function properly, the EBI server has to be running. It should look something like this:


ebi server

2.3.Test Harness #

The Cardholder Services installation comes with a Test Harness application to check functionality. It is typically located at:
C:\Program Files (x86)\Honeywell\Server\user\CardholderServicesTestHarness.exe
Usage of the test harness is not covered here, but if you can “Get All Types” on the Cardholders tab, you are communicating with EBI through Cardholder Services correctly.

2.4.SQL Scripts #

The EBI install should come with two SQL Scripts to enable the Users location and Zones as well as access rights / zones as UserTables through Cardholder Services. These files are named and should have been made available with the updated patch from Honeywell.

These scripts should be run on the EBI database by the SQL Server administrator.

3.XPressEntry 데이터 관리자 동기화 설정 #

XPressEntry and EBI communicate through the EBI Cardholder Services interface. From the XPressEntry side, this done by a module called Data Manager. This section will describe how to set up and get the Data Manager running for EBI.

3.1.XPressEntry 동기화 사용 #

XPressEntry의 기본 페이지에서 XPressEntry / Settings (Ctrl + S)


xpressentry synchronization honeywell ebi

3.2.데이터 관리자 탭 #

From the Settings Page Select the Data Manager Tab. When it is empty it looks like this:


xpressentry set up honeywell ebi

From the ‘Type’ Combo Box, select “Honeywell EBI”.


xpressentry set up type honeywell ebi

3.2.1.Update Frequency #

업데이트주기를 시스템 업데이트주기만큼 자주 설정하십시오. 한 번에 하나의 업데이트 만 실행할 수 있으며이 값이 너무 낮 으면 시스템에서 끊임없이 업데이트를 시도합니다 (항상 문제가되는 것은 아닙니다).

For EBI Installations, we want to set both the Activity Update Frequency and the Full Sync Update frequency. Activity Update will fill the locations of the users in EBI at the given frequency. Full Sync will do the rest of the updates. Partial Synchronization is not used with EBI.

3.2.2.로그 수준 #

원하는 Log Level을 선택하십시오. 시스템을 설정할 때 SQL이 제안 된 로그 레벨입니다. 시스템이 정상적으로 작동하고 원하는대로 작동하면 CRITICAL이 기본 로그 수준이되어야합니다.

3.2.3.Activity Synchronizing #

Activity Synchronizing is not done with EBI at this time and these checkboxes will have no effect when you have EBI selected and set up.

3.3.Honeywell EBI Setup Page #

Press the “Setup Data Manager” button to get the EBI specific setup screen.


honeywell ebi data manager set up

The first thing to do from this page is fill in the primary EBI server which has Cardholder Services running.

3.3.1.Important Fields #

There are 3 important fields to fill out on this page:

  1. Primary Server – the name or IP address of the primary EBI server
  2. Username – A valid administrator on the EBI server
  3. Password – The password for that user.

These credentials should be supplied by your EBI administrator.

Once you’ve filled out the basic information, the button: “Get Server Information” or “Test Connect” will attempt to connect to the server.
Redundancy information will be automatically filled out if you press the “Get Server Information” button. If your connection fails, check the text box at the bottom of the screen for information on the failure.

3.3.2.Other Fields #

Compare Transit Date – should be checked. It will compare the Users/Zones TRANSIT_DATE field from EBI with the last scan date in XPressEntry. The later date will be applied as the user current location.

User Tables – These fields should not change from the defaults unless the SQL Server Administrator specifies a change.

When you are done with this step, press OK to send the setup information back to XPressEntry Data Manager.

IMPORTANT: You MUST press the “Save and apply settings”button for any data manager changes to take effect!

After you’ve saved, you can press the “Full Sync Now”button to synchronize XPressEntry with EBI. Make sure you’ve set the synchronization update frequency on the main Data Manager tab.

When the Data Manager is setup and running with EBI, it should look something like this:


xpressentry set up page save and apply

4.XPressEntry 데이터 설정 #

Once the EBI System is set up and synchronizing, you will see the EBI data represented in XPressEntry under the Add/Edit Info tab. Data which is imported from EBI cannot be changed by default and is grayed out / read-only.

4.1.외부 데이터 편집 허용 #

동기화 된 후 어떤 이유로 든이 데이터를 편집하려면 기본 설정 탭의 설정을 사용하여 데이터를 수정할 수 있습니다.


xpressentry settings allowing editing of external data

4.2.독자 #

Readers for EBI Synchronization are strictly an XPressEntry entity. You can set up your readers to have one or many different configurations at a given time. This is done by selecting a Reader Profile for the reader.

물리적 및 논리적 리더 인 XPressEntry에는 두 가지 유형의 리더가 있습니다.

4.2.1.물리적 리더 #

XPressEntry 시스템의 물리적 판독기는 서버와 통신하도록 설정된 핸드 헬드 또는 기타 장치입니다. 장치의 GUID 필드로 고유하게 식별됩니다.
매우 자주 물리적 판독기는 다음과 같이 길고 무의미한 이름을 갖습니다. 570069006E00430045000000-00-008703124863. 이 판독기는 일단 동기화되면 GUID를 장치의 기본 이름으로 사용합니다.

4.2.2.논리적 리더 #

Logical readers are readers in the system which are usually placeholders for physical readers.


xpressentry reader name

4.2.3.물리적 / 논리적 리더 병합 #

참고 :이 프로세스는 되돌릴 수 없습니다!
To merge the logical and physical readers do the following:

  1. Select the Logical Reader from the Add/Edit Info Readers tab
  2. Under “Merge with Physical Reader”, select the physical reader as identified by its name (typically the GUID) from the drop-down list “Reader Name”.
  3. "병합 수행"을 누르십시오.

병합중인 정확한 리더의 GUID를 모르는 경우 판독기 GUID는 설정 페이지의 '더보기'탭 아래에있는 핸드 헬드 장치에서 사용할 수 있습니다.

4.3.독자 프로필 #

All readers in the XPressEntry system need a reader profile set up for them. These can be shared across readers with identical responsibilities. See the main XPressEntry manual for more information.

4.4. #

Doors are portals from one zone to a different zone. They are a logical way to move from one zone to another. They are primarily used by XPressEntry for handhelds in Entry/Exit mode.

사용자는 "시작 영역"-> "종료 영역"에서 문을 "입력"하고 있습니다. 사용자는 "종료"문을 끝 영역에서 시작합니다 -> 시작 영역

When using XPressEntry for Entry/Exit mode, you should set up XPressEntry to have at least one door and make sure the zones make sense for the EBI integration. If you’ve already synchronized the activities from EBI, you should see the EBI zones here.

4.5.영역 #

XPressEntry에는 두 가지 유형의 영역이 있습니다. "외부"영역은 XPressEntry가 추적하는 위치 외부의 영역을 모으고 표현하는 데 사용됩니다. 다른 모든 구역은 시스템의 일부로 간주됩니다. 점유는 비 외부 영역에있는 사용자에 대해서만 추적됩니다.

As explained below, all zones are coming directly from EBI. The Groups are the same as the Behavior Models in EBI. This information can all be verified in XPressEntry, but it is set in the EBI system.


xpressentry zones honeywell ebi

수정 제안